I1I2278Application of sections 279 to 284
1
Sections 279 to 284 apply to premises (other than a vehicle)—
a
in respect of which an on-premises alcohol licence or relevant Scottish licence has effect,
b
which contain a bar at which alcohol is served for consumption on the premises (without a requirement that alcohol is served only with food), and
c
at a time when alcohol may be supplied in reliance on the alcohol licence or sold for consumption on the premises in reliance on the relevant Scottish licence.
2
In those sections a reference to a licensing authority includes a reference to the Sub-Treasurer of the Inner Temple and the Under-Treasurer of the Middle Temple.
